Abstract: | The problem of an elliptical crack embedded in an unbounded transversely isotropic piezoelectric media with the crack-plane
parallel to the plane of isotropy of the media and subjected to remote normal mechanical as well as electric loading is considered
first. The problem has been successfully reduced to a pair of coupled integral equations that are suitable for the application
of an integral equation method developed earlier for three-dimensional problems of LEFM. Solution to the mechanical displacement
and electric potentials are obtained for prescribed uniform loadings and expressions for corresponding intensity factors and
crack opening displacement are deduced. The above method has further been applied to solve the problem of a rigid flat-ended
elliptical punch indenting a transversely isotropic piezoelectric half-space surface with the plane of isotropy parallel to
the surface. Solutions to mechanical stress and electric displacement are obtained for prescribed constant normal displacement
and constant electric potential interior to the elliptical region and expression for the total force required to maintain
a prescribed indentation is deduced. |
